In 2007, Forbes reported that Sheindlin had signed a four-year contract for $100 million in 2004 and estimated her net worth to be $95 million. Judge Judy was the only woman in a class of 126 students at American University's Washington College of Law, before finishing her law degree at New York Law School. She continued her education at American University's Washington College of Law, where she was the only woman in a class of 126 students. Thanks to that windfall, Forbes named Sheindlin the world's highest-paid TV host in 2018. Sheindlin has a net worth of $480 million and, since 2012, has earned approximately $47 million a year. Four years later, she was promoted to the position of supervising judge in the Manhattan division of the family court. Judge Judy co-founded Her Honor Mentoring with her daughter, Nicole Sheindlin, in 2006. Sworn written direct examinations or proffers should be used for evidentiary hearings and trials unless the Court otherwise authorizes or directs.
